Description
The formation of the Wannon Waterfalls resulted from the directional flow of lava to Wannon River, resulting in the spectacular display of waterfall that is seen today.
Downstream, visitors are treated to the sight of rapids as the water carves its way around the gigantic basalt rocks. The viewing platform located at the falls offers amazing views of the land beyond.
Close by, a rotunda displays interpretative media for visitors to the falls.
There are a number of walking trails near to Wannon Falls which range from easy to moderate in difficulty.
The waterfall is at it's best during June and October.
